Basongo (BAN) to Zagreb (ZAG)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Basongo Airport (BAN) in Basongo, DR Congo to Zagreb Airport (ZAG) in Zagreb, Croatia is 5,583 kilometers (3,469 miles / 3,015 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 8h, flying north at a heading of 356°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ting DR Congo with Croatia. It is an intercontinental flight between Africa and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 16:17 in Basongo, it's 15:17 in Zagreb.

There is a significant elevation difference of 1,287 feet between the two airports. Zagreb Airport sits lower than Basongo Airport.

The return flight from Zagreb (ZAG) to Basongo (BAN) follows a heading of 174° (south).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
